Key Attractions

Hakone Full-Day Private Tour By Public Transportation - Key Attractions

Hakone Shrine, a serene Shinto shrine nestled at the base of Mount Hakone, stands as one of the tour’s key attractions.

Visitors can stroll through the lush forest and admire the iconic red torii gate that guards the entrance.

The tour also includes a visit to Lake Ashinoko, a picturesque crater lake formed by a volcanic eruption.

Owakudani Valley, a volcanic area known for its bubbling hot springs and sulfurous fumes, offers a unique geological experience.

Finally, the Hakone Open-Air Museum showcases various sculptures and art installations within a scenic mountain setting.

Getting to Hakone

Hakone Full-Day Private Tour By Public Transportation - Getting to Hakone

How does one reach the picturesque Hakone region from Tokyo? The tour offers convenient public transportation options for getting to Hakone.

Participants can take the Odakyu Romance Car express train from Shinjuku Station in Tokyo, which takes around 85 minutes. Alternatively, the Hakone Tozan Railway offers a scenic mountain route to Hakone.

The tour’s English-speaking guide navigates the public transit system, helping customers reach the main attractions with ease. This makes the tour ideal for Japan Rail Pass holders or those unfamiliar with local transportation.

The guided aspect ensures a seamless journey to explore Hakone’s natural wonders.
